Airworthiness Directives; Bell Helicopter Textron, Inc. Model 204B, 205A, 205A-1, 205B, 210, 212, 412, 412EP, and 412CF Helicopters
Document Number: E7-22439
Type: Rule
Date: 2007-11-20
Agency: Federal Aviation Administration, Department of Transportation
This document publishes in the Federal Register an amendment adopting Airworthiness Directive (AD) 2007-19-53, which was sent previously to all known U.S. owners and operators of the specified Bell Helicopter Textron, Inc. (BHTI) model helicopters by individual letters. This AD requires replacing each affected tail rotor blade (blade) with an airworthy blade with a serial number not listed in the applicability of this AD. This AD is prompted by three incidents in which blade tip weights were slung from the blades during flight causing significant vibration. The actions specified by this AD are intended to prevent loss of a blade tip weight, loss of a blade, and subsequent loss of control of the helicopter.

Airworthiness Directives; Cessna Aircraft Company, Model 525B Airplanes
Document Number: E7-22304
Type: Rule
Date: 2007-11-20
Agency: Federal Aviation Administration, Department of Transportation
The FAA is adopting a new airworthiness directive (AD) for certain Cessna Aircraft Company (Cessna) Model 525B airplanes. This AD requires you to incorporate electrical power relay circuit protection kit part number (P/N) SB525B-24-02. This AD results from both the need to protect aircraft wiring left unprotected in the original design and a report of a Model 525B airplane experiencing in-flight loss of numerous systems, tripped circuit breakers, and burned wiring adjacent to the power distribution panel. We are issuing this AD to correct an incorrect wiring installation and to provide short-circuit protection for all wiring from the aircraft power distribution system. This condition could result in burned wiring and loss of various aircraft electrical systems.

Airworthiness Directives; Boeing Model 737-600, 737-700, 737-700C, 737-800, and 737-900 Series Airplanes
Document Number: E7-22548
Type: Proposed Rule
Date: 2007-11-19
Agency: Federal Aviation Administration, Department of Transportation
The FAA proposes to adopt a new airworthiness directive (AD) for certain Boeing Model 737-600, 737-700, 737-700C, 737-800, and 737- 900 series airplanes. This proposed AD would require an inspection of the vertical fin lugs, skin, and skin edges for discrepancies, an inspection of the flight control cables, fittings, and pulleys in section 48 for signs of corrosion, an inspection of the horizontal stabilizer jackscrew, ball nut, and gimbal pins for signs of corrosion, and corrective actions if necessary. This proposed AD results from reports indicating that moisture was found within the section 48 cavity. We are proposing this AD to ensure that the correct amount of sealant was applied around the vertical fin lugs, skin and the skin edges. Missing sealant could result in icing of the elevator cables, which could cause a system jam and corrosion of structural and flight control parts, resulting in reduced controllability of the airplane.

Airworthiness Directives; Boeing Model 767-200, -300, -300F, and -400ER Series Airplanes
Document Number: E7-22543
Type: Proposed Rule
Date: 2007-11-19
Agency: Federal Aviation Administration, Department of Transportation
The FAA proposes to supersede an existing airworthiness directive (AD) that applies to certain Boeing Model 767-200, -300, and -300F series airplanes. The existing AD currently requires reworking the surface of the ground stud bracket of the left and right transformer rectifier units (TRUs) and the airplane structure mounting surface, and measuring the resistance from the bracket to the structure and the ground lugs to the bracket using a bonding meter. This proposed AD would revise the applicability of the existing AD to include additional airplanes and would also require, among other actions, installation of a new ground stud bracket using faying surface bonding. This proposed AD results from a report of loss of all direct current (DC) power generation during a flight, due to inadequate electrical ground path between the ground bracket of the TRUs/main battery charger (MBC) and the structure. We are proposing this AD to prevent depletion of the main battery while in flight, resulting from the loss of both TRUs and the MBC, and consequent loss of all DC power, which could impact the safe flight and landing of the airplane due to the loss of function or malfunction of essential/critical systems and displays in the cockpit.

Airworthiness Directives; Boeing Model 747 Series Airplanes Powered by General Electric (GE) CF6-45/50, Pratt & Whitney (P&W) JT9D-70, or JT9D-7 Series Engines
Document Number: E7-22329
Type: Proposed Rule
Date: 2007-11-15
Agency: Federal Aviation Administration, Department of Transportation
This action withdraws a notice of proposed rulemaking (NPRM) that proposed a new airworthiness directive (AD), applicable to certain Boeing Model 747 series airplanes powered by GE CF6-45/50, P&W JT9D-70, or JT9D-7 series engines. That action would have required repetitive inspections to find cracks and broken fasteners of the inboard and outboard nacelle struts of the rear engine mount bulkhead, and repair, if necessary. For certain airplanes, that action would have provided for an optional terminating modification for the inspections of the outboard nacelle struts. Since the issuance of the NPRM, the Federal Aviation Administration (FAA) has received new data of other issues related to the unsafe condition. The data include many new reports of additional web and frame cracks and sheared attachment fasteners, and reports of cracks on the outboard struts of airplanes not identified in the applicability of the NPRM, in addition to the comments received for the NPRM. We have determined from these data that the corrective actions required by the NPRM are inadequate for addressing the identified unsafe condition. Accordingly, the proposed rule is withdrawn.

Airworthiness Directives; Cessna Model 560 Airplanes
Document Number: E7-22179
Type: Rule
Date: 2007-11-15
Agency: Federal Aviation Administration, Department of Transportation
The FAA is adopting a new airworthiness directive (AD) for certain Cessna Model 560 airplanes. This AD requires installing new minimum airspeed placards to notify the flightcrew of the proper airspeeds for operating in both normal and icing conditions. This AD also requires revising the airplane flight manual to provide limitations and procedures for operating in icing conditions, for operating with anti-ice systems selected ``on'' independent of icing conditions, and for recognizing and recovering from inadvertent stall. This AD also provides an optional terminating action for the placard installation. This AD results from an evaluation of in-service airplanes following an accident. The evaluation indicated that some airplanes may have an improperly adjusted stall warning system. We are issuing this AD to prevent an inadvertent stall due to the inadequate stall warning margin provided by an improperly adjusted stall warning system, which could result in loss of controllability of the airplane.
Airworthiness Directives; Boeing Model 737-600, -700, -700C, -800 and -900 Series Airplanes
Document Number: E7-22000
Type: Rule
Date: 2007-11-15
Agency: Federal Aviation Administration, Department of Transportation
The FAA is adopting a new airworthiness directive (AD) for certain Boeing Model 737-600, -700, -700C, -800 and -900 series airplanes. This AD requires an inspection of the fillet sealant at the inboard and outboard sides of the receptacles in the wheel wells of the main landing gear, and related investigative/corrective actions if necessary. This AD results from reports of in-production airplanes with missing or insufficient fillet sealant around the receptacles at the disconnect bracket. We are issuing this AD to prevent corrosion damage due to missing or insufficient fillet sealant. Such corrosion could result in insufficient electrical bonding between the connectors and the disconnect bracket, and consequent loss of the shielding that protects the wire bundles from lightning, electromagnetic interference (EMI), and high intensity radiated field (HIRF). Loss of lightning, EMI, and HIRF protection at those receptacles could cause failure of multiple electrical systems and subsequent loss of several critical control systems that are necessary for safe flight. In addition, a lightning strike could cause arcing in the fuel tank; this potential ignition source, in combination with flammable fuel vapors, could result in a fuel tank explosion and consequent loss of the airplane.

Airworthiness Directives; Boeing Model 747-400, 747-400D, and 747-400F Series Airplanes; Model 757-200 Series Airplanes; and Model 767-200, 767-300, and 767-300F Series Airplanes
Document Number: E7-21991
Type: Rule
Date: 2007-11-15
Agency: Federal Aviation Administration, Department of Transportation
The FAA is adopting a new airworthiness directive (AD) for certain Boeing Model 747-400, 747-400D, 747-400F, 757-200, 767-200, 767-300, and 767-300F series airplanes. This AD requires inspecting to determine the date code of the time delay relay for the cargo fire suppression system, and replacing the relay if necessary. This AD results from a report indicating that failure of a time delay relay on an ELMS (electrical load management system) panel led to testing of other time delay relays at Boeing and at the supplier. Similar relays are used in the cargo fire suppression system. The time delay relay controls when the secondary fire bottles discharge. We are issuing this AD to ensure there is sufficient fire suppressant to control a cargo fire if the airplane is more than the relay delay time from a suitable airport, which could result in an uncontrollable fire in the cargo compartment.

Airworthiness Directives; Boeing Model 737-100, -200, -200C, -300, -400, and -500 Series Airplanes
Document Number: E7-22104
Type: Proposed Rule
Date: 2007-11-13
Agency: Federal Aviation Administration, Department of Transportation
The FAA proposes to adopt a new airworthiness directive (AD) for certain Boeing Model 737-100, -200, -200C, -300, -400, and -500 series airplanes. This proposed AD would require various repetitive inspections for cracking of the upper frame to side frame splice of the fuselage, and other specified and corrective actions if necessary. This proposed AD also provides for an optional preventive modification, which would terminate the repetitive inspections. This proposed AD results from a report that the upper frame of the fuselage was severed between stringers S-13L and S-14L at station 747, and the adjacent frame at station 767 had a 1.3-inch-long crack at the same stringer location. We are proposing this AD to detect and correct fatigue cracking of the upper frame to side frame splice of the fuselage, which could result in reduced structural integrity of the frame and adjacent lap joint. This reduced structural integrity can increase loading in the fuselage skin, which will accelerate skin crack growth and result in decompression of the airplane.
